Education & Childcare Choices in Malibu

Malibu’s options for early childhood education reflect its commitment to high-quality living. There are various accredited preschools and daycares like the Malibu Preschool, which is loved for its holistic approach to child development, integrating outdoor play and learning seamlessly. For parents thinking long-term, the proximity to institutions like Pepperdine University ensures that educationally, families are set from preschool to university.

Healthcare Services: Pediatric Care in a Serene Setting

Healthcare in Malibu is top-notch, with facilities like UCLA Health Malibu providing comprehensive pediatric services. This local clinic not only offers regular health check-ups and vaccinations but also specializes in developmental screenings, ensuring that children in Malibu grow up healthy and well-monitored. The serene environment adds a calming backdrop to healthcare visits, which can be a relief for both kids and parents.

Exploring the Great Outdoors: Parks and Playgrounds

When it comes to outdoor activities, Malibu’s natural landscape offers vast opportunities for families to explore and relax. Zuma Beach is perfect for a family day out, with its clean, guarded beaches and picnic areas. Meanwhile, Malibu Bluffs Park offers playgrounds and open spaces ideal for kite flying, toddler playdates, and family picnics. Regular yoga in the park and community activities add to the family-friendly vibe.

Family-Friendly Attractions: Fun Beyond the Sand

Apart from the famous beaches, Malibu holds treasures like the Malibu Lagoon Museum, where families can learn about the local marine life and history. The Adamson House next door offers guided tours that are engaging for parents and can be a fascinating outing for older children. Additionally, seasonal events like the Malibu Chili Cook-Off bring the community together for family-friendly fun.

Housing and Living: Embracing Coastal Comfort

While housing in Malibu is on the pricier side, the benefits of safe, clean neighborhoods and stunning views can justify the costs for many. The market offers various family-oriented homes and the community is commendable in its efforts to maintain beautification and safety. Utilities and amenities, though expensive, are readily available and of high quality.

Safe and Secure: A Community Focused on Well-being

Safety in Malabi is taken seriously, evident in its low crime rates and well-maintained public spaces. The local police are visible and community-oriented, often participating in local school programs and community events, creating a safe atmosphere conducive to raising families.

Building Connections: Community Support and Events

Malibu is not just about beautiful landscapes and quality amenities but is also rich in community spirit. There are numerous parent groups and activities through libraries, churches, and community centers that provide strong support networks for families. Events like the annual Malibu Arts Festival not only celebrate local talents but are also great for family outings.

Pros:

  1. High-quality education and childcare services.
  2. Excellent pediatric healthcare services.
  3. Rich in natural landscapes and outdoor activities.
  4. Strong community spirit and safe neighborhoods.
  5. Proximity to cultural and educational hubs like Los Angeles.

Cons:

  1. High cost of living and expensive real estate.
  2. Limited public transportation options.
  3. Smaller, more limited job market.
  4. Risk of natural disasters such as wildfires and mudslides.
  5. Educational institutions are excellent but few in number.
